大发彩票VIP会员查询系统开发与实现大发彩票vip查询
本文目录导读:
随着彩票行业的快速发展,彩票公司为了提升品牌形象、增强客户粘性以及提供更优质的服务,越来越多的彩票机构开始引入VIP会员制度,为了实现高效的会员管理和服务,大发彩票公司开发了一套专业的VIP会员查询系统,本文将详细介绍该系统的开发背景、功能设计、技术实现以及实际应用效果。
系统目标
大发彩票VIP会员查询系统旨在为彩票公司提供一个高效、安全、便捷的会员查询服务,系统的主要目标包括:
- 提供会员的基本信息查询,如会员ID、姓名、注册时间等。
- 实现会员订单查询功能,包括会员当前的所有订单及其状态。
- 支持会员历史订单查询,便于用户回顾购买记录。
- 提供会员积分查询功能,展示会员累计积分情况。
- 实现会员信息的更新与维护,确保数据的准确性和完整性。
系统架构
系统采用分层架构设计,主要包括以下几个部分:
- 数据库层:使用MySQL数据库进行数据存储和管理,支持高效的查询和增删改查操作。
- 中间件层:使用Java Spring框架进行业务逻辑处理,确保系统的高可用性和扩展性。
- 用户界面层:基于JavaFX开发图形用户界面,提供直观的操作界面。
- 后台服务层:提供API接口,支持与其他系统的数据交互。
功能模块设计
会员信息查询
该功能允许用户查询会员的基本信息,包括会员ID、姓名、注册时间、活跃状态等,系统通过数据库查询相关记录,并将结果返回给用户,用户可以使用不同的查询条件,如查询所有会员、按地区筛选、按活跃状态筛选等。
订单查询
订单查询功能支持用户查询所有订单信息,包括订单ID、会员ID、订单金额、订单状态(如已付款、已发货、已完成等)等,系统支持按时间范围筛选订单,用户可以查看订单的详细信息,并统计订单数量。
历史订单查询
历史订单查询功能允许用户查看过去一段时间内的订单记录,系统支持自定义时间范围,如过去7天、过去30天等,并提供订单详情的查看功能。
积分查询
积分查询功能显示用户当前的积分情况,包括基础积分和额外积分,系统会根据用户的活跃度(如购买次数、参与活动次数等)自动计算积分,并展示积分的明细。
会员状态查询
会员状态查询功能显示会员的当前状态,如活跃会员、暂停会员、删除会员等,系统会根据会员的注册时间和最后登录时间进行状态判断。
技术实现
数据库设计
系统采用MySQL数据库进行数据存储,设计如下:
- 会员信息表:存储会员的基本信息,包括会员ID、姓名、注册时间、最后登录时间、活跃状态、积分等。
- 订单信息表:存储会员的所有订单记录,包括订单ID、会员ID、订单金额、订单状态、订单时间等。
- 活动记录表:存储会员参与的各种活动记录,包括活动ID、会员ID、参与时间、积分奖励等。
功能实现
- 查询功能:使用MySQL的高级查询语言(SQL)实现多种查询条件的组合,如按条件筛选、排序等。
- 数据缓存:为了提高查询效率,系统对 frequently accessed data 进行缓存,减少数据库查询的时间。
- 错误处理:系统对非法查询、无效数据等进行严格的错误处理,并返回相应的错误信息。
用户界面设计
用户界面采用JavaFX开发,设计简洁直观,操作方便,界面分为几个主要部分:
- 搜索框:用于输入查询条件。
- 列表视图:显示查询结果。
- 设置视图:允许用户切换不同的视图模式(如表格视图、列表视图等)。
系统优势
- 高效性:系统通过数据库查询优化和数据缓存技术,确保查询操作快速响应。
- 安全性:系统采用严格的权限控制和数据加密技术,确保用户数据的安全性。
- 易用性:用户界面设计直观,操作简单,即使是普通用户也能轻松上手。
- 扩展性:系统架构设计灵活,支持未来的功能扩展和数据源的增加。
大发彩票VIP会员查询系统通过高效的数据查询、便捷的操作界面和强大的安全机制,为彩票公司提供了强有力的支持,系统不仅提升了会员管理的效率,还增强了客户对公司的信任感,我们还将继续优化系统功能,提供更多实用的会员管理服务,为彩票行业的发展做出更大的贡献。
大发彩票VIP会员查询系统开发与实现大发彩票vip查询,
发表评论